Ethan Bai's human form looks like a two or three-year-old baby, with a lively face, baby fat, short arms and legs, and a short body, except for his long ears, which are white and fluffy with pink fur on his shoulders. Since he changed into a human form, he would stand up and walk stumblingly. He didn't need to be taught, but he would always jump after walking a few steps. Yun Qing focused on correcting this problem.
This little white rabbit was already intelligent before he became a spirit. He could understand most of what others said by guessing, but when it was his turn to speak, he had to learn seriously, so Yun Qing taught him something every day. Ethan Bai had a basic foundation and studied hard. After more than a month of becoming a spirit, he had no problem communicating with Yun Qing using short sentences.
In the past, since the two were of different species and there was no comparison, Yun Qing would always call him "Brother Rabbit" for fun, but this time the little rabbit had become a tiny child, so Yun Qing felt awkward calling him "brother". Considering that he might teach Ethan Bai Taoism in the future, he simply regarded himself as a master, and acted pretentiously in front of Ethan Bai, and felt very happy when he saw the child worshiping him with respectful eyes every day.
That day, Yun Zhen came to Yun Qing's room, holding a stack of neatly folded small pants and a children's sun hat in his hands. Little Ethan Bai's ears and tail could not be folded back, so the pants and hat had to be modified by Yun Zhen before they could be worn comfortably. A hole had to be made at the back of the pants to hold the round tail, and two openings had to be made on the top of the hat to make it convenient to take out the ears when wearing the hat.
In the room, Yun Qing was teaching Ethan Bai to speak. When he saw Yun Zhen walk in, he raised his hand and pointed at the apprentice who was testing him: "Who is this?"
